Lychen, Brandenburg, Germany
Overview
Lychen is a small lakeside town in Brandenburg, Germany, renowned for its natural beauty and serene atmosphere. Surrounded by forests and lakes, it offers a tranquil escape with a rich history reflected in its charming old town. Lychen is popular for eco-tourism, relaxing weekends, and outdoor activities.

Local Tips
Bring cash as some small businesses may not accept cards. Rent a bike to explore the scenic trails and lakes efficiently.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is customary (5-10%), dress is casual but tidy, and a friendly greeting goes a long way with locals.
Safety Warnings
Lychen is generally very safe; however, be cautious near lakes after dark and always lock valuables, especially at busy tourist spots.
Hidden Gems
Visit the Draisinenbahn for pedal-powered railway fun, explore the tranquil Großer Lychensee, and check out the quirky Sanddornhof for sea buckthorn products.
